That is possibly over-cautious. I have a machine that requires the SMI patch, but I also regularly run compiles on it too, and every time I do that it wipes out the changes to rtapi.conf (One day I will change the .in file and get rid of this problem). This means that quite often I run parts with the SMI patch missing, and with very high latency spikes (600,000) every 64 seconds. So far I have not actually seen any problems (though I am using a 7i43.) manifested in the parts.
